Andie MacDowell, an American actress and former fashion model, gained critical acclaim and won an Independent Spirit Award for Best Female Lead for her role in the 1989 independent drama Sex, Lies, and Videotape. She is best known for her performances in films such as Groundhog Day, Four Weddings and a Funeral, and Green Card, as well as her appearances in popular TV shows like Jane by Design and Cedar Cove. Since 1986, MacDowell has been a spokesperson for L’Oréal. Notably, she is recognized for fully committing to her roles, even in films that did not receive positive reviews from critics.
